- Editor's Notes
- [from Paris; addressed to TAE @ Orange] The Grand Jury confirmed, as I suppose everyone expected it would, this award of the "Diplome d'Honneur" to you, then "Grand Prix" for your grand exhibit and inventions##I do not suppose that there is the slightest probability of the "Superior Commission" disturbing this award. Should any danger appear, I shall stay--as I am a member of that body--and work with it until the awards of the lower juries are passed upon. But I do not think it will be necessary. Yours truly R. H. Thurston
